muckrack:
Over two years ago Muck Rack launched the definitive list of journalists on Twitter. Now we’ve assembled a list of journalists on Google+ by going through the 500 most followed journalists we’ve verified on Muck Rack. It so happened 140 (an omen?) of those 500 were on Google+. United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on On... →
From the UN Media Center
22 July 2011 –
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on voiced his shock after a large bomb blast struck the centre of the Norwegian capital, Oslo, earlier today, killing at least seven people and injuring many more.

NASA Layoffs Planned as Space Shuttle Program Ends →
/sigh Where space-geek dreams go to die…
abcnewsradio:
(HOUSTON) — Now that space shuttle Atlantis has returned home safely, America’s human spaceflight program faces a period of retrenchment and doubt.
